- 1、本文档共21页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
PAGE1
PAGE1
ABB800xA系统优化与维护
1.系统性能监控
1.1实时数据监控
实时数据监控是确保ABB800xA系统稳定运行的关键环节。通过监控系统的实时数据,可以及时发现并解决潜在的问题,提高系统的可靠性和效率。ABB800xA系统提供了多种工具和方法来实现这一目标,包括使用系统自带的监控软件和第三方工具。
1.1.1使用ABB800xA自带的监控软件
ABB800xA系统自带的监控软件如800xAHistorian和800xAAlarmEventViewer,可以帮助用户实时监控系统的运行状态和历史数据。以下是一个使用800xAHistorian进行实时数据监控的步骤:
打开800xAHistorian:
在系统主菜单中选择“Tools”“Historian”“TrendViewer”。
选择监控的数据点:
在“TrendViewer”中,点击“Add”按钮,选择需要监控的数据点。例如,选择压力传感器、温度传感器等关键参数。
配置监控时间间隔:
在“TrendViewer”中,设置数据点的采集时间间隔,例如每5秒采集一次数据。
查看实时趋势图:
点击“Start”按钮,系统将实时显示选定数据点的趋势图。
1.1.2使用第三方监控工具
除了使用ABB800xA自带的监控软件,还可以集成第三方监控工具,如OPC(OLEforProcessControl)服务器,以实现更灵活的数据监控和分析。以下是一个使用Python和OPC服务器进行实时数据监控的例子:
#导入必要的库
importopc
importtime
#连接到OPC服务器
client=opc.Client(opc.tcp://localhost:4840)
#定义要监控的数据点
tags=[
PressureSensor1,
TemperatureSensor1,
FlowRateSensor1
]
#实时监控数据
whileTrue:
#读取数据点的值
values=client.read(tags)
#打印每个数据点的值
fortag,valueinzip(tags,values):
print(f{tag}:{value})
#每5秒采集一次数据
time.sleep(5)
1.2性能指标分析
性能指标分析是系统优化的基础。通过分析系统的关键性能指标(KPIs),可以深入了解系统的运行状态,找出瓶颈并进行优化。ABB800xA系统提供了多种性能指标,包括响应时间、CPU利用率、内存使用率等。
1.2.1响应时间分析
响应时间是指系统从接收到命令到执行命令所需的时间。响应时间过长可能会导致控制不及时,影响生产过程。以下是一个使用ABB800xAHistorian分析响应时间的步骤:
选择监控的数据点:
在“TrendViewer”中,选择需要监控的响应时间数据点。例如,选择控制回路的响应时间。
设置时间范围:
在“TrendViewer”中,设置需要分析的时间范围,例如过去24小时的数据。
查看趋势图:
点击“Start”按钮,系统将显示选定数据点的响应时间趋势图。通过趋势图可以发现响应时间的波动情况,进一步分析问题原因。
1.2.2CPU利用率分析
CPU利用率是衡量系统负载的重要指标。过高的CPU利用率可能会导致系统性能下降,影响控制精度。以下是一个使用ABB800xAHistorian分析CPU利用率的步骤:
选择监控的数据点:
在“TrendViewer”中,选择需要监控的CPU利用率数据点。例如,选择控制器的CPU利用率。
设置时间范围:
在“TrendViewer”中,设置需要分析的时间范围,例如过去24小时的数据。
查看趋势图:
点击“Start”按钮,系统将显示选定数据点的CPU利用率趋势图。通过趋势图可以发现CPU利用率的波动情况,进一步分析问题原因。
1.3故障诊断与排除
故障诊断与排除是确保系统稳定运行的重要环节。通过系统自带的故障诊断工具和日志分析,可以快速定位和解决系统故障,减少停机时间。
1.3.1使用800xAAlarmEventViewer
800xAAlarmEventViewer是一个强大的故障诊断工具,可以实时显示系统中的报警和事件。以下是一个使用800xAAlarmEventViewer进行故障诊断的步骤:
打开800xAAlarmEventViewer:
在系统主菜单中选择
您可能关注的文档
- 核能监控与数据采集系统(SCADA)系列:Siemens SIMATIC WinCC_(10).WinCC系统网络配置与通信协议.docx
- 核能监控与数据采集系统(SCADA)系列:Siemens SIMATIC WinCC_(11).冗余与故障恢复机制.docx
- 核能监控与数据采集系统(SCADA)系列:Siemens SIMATIC WinCC_(12).系统维护与故障诊断.docx
- 核能监控与数据采集系统(SCADA)系列:Siemens SIMATIC WinCC_(13).核能监控项目案例分析.docx
- 核能监控与数据采集系统(SCADA)系列:Siemens SIMATIC WinCC_(16).安全防护与访问控制.docx
- 核能监控与数据采集系统(SCADA)系列:Siemens SIMATIC WinCC_(18).用户培训与认证.docx
- 核能监控与数据采集系统(SCADA)系列:Siemens SIMATIC WinCC_(19).系统性能优化与扩展.docx
- 核能监控与数据采集系统(SCADA)系列:Wonderware InTouch_(5).InTouch图形用户界面设计.docx
- 核能监控与数据采集系统(SCADA)系列:Wonderware InTouch_(6).InTouch报警与事件管理.docx
- 核能监控与数据采集系统(SCADA)系列:Wonderware InTouch_(7).数据采集与处理技术.docx
文档评论(0)